Management Commentary

During the earnings call, EVLV leadership focused discussion on operational progress achieved over the quarter, rather than detailed financial performance, given the lack of disclosed revenue data. Management noted ongoing expansion of the company’s core weapons detection system deployments across a range of high-foot-traffic venues, including K-12 school campuses, professional sports arenas, and large corporate office parks. They also highlighted ongoing investment in artificial intelligence model training to reduce false positive alert rates, a key pain point for end users in the physical security space. Leadership acknowledged the reported negative EPS figure, framing the result as consistent with previously communicated plans to prioritize market share capture and product development over near-term profitability. Forward Guidance

EVLV did not issue specific quantitative forward guidance for upcoming periods during the the previous quarter earnings call, consistent with the company’s disclosure practices from recent quarterly releases. Leadership did, however, reference potential long-term market opportunities that could shape the company’s performance over time, including rising demand for non-intrusive security screening solutions, growing adoption of cloud-integrated security management platforms among enterprise and public sector clients, and potential cost efficiencies from scaled manufacturing of the company’s hardware units. Analysts following the stock note that the absence of formal quantitative guidance may lead to wider consensus estimate ranges in the near term, as market participants incorporate differing assumptions around customer acquisition costs and deployment ramp-up speeds into their valuation models. Market Reaction

Following the release of the the previous quarter results, trading in EVLV shares saw moderately elevated volume in the first two sessions post-disclosure, per aggregated market data. Sell-side analysts covering the security technology sector have offered mixed reactions to the results: some note that the reported EPS figure was roughly in line with pre-release consensus estimates, while others have called for additional transparency around top-line performance in future filings to help investors better assess the company’s growth trajectory. Options activity in EVLV in recent weeks has reflected modest uncertainty, with roughly equal volumes of near-term call and put contracts traded as of this month. Broader sector trends, including proposed increases in U.S. federal funding for K-12 school security, could potentially influence investor sentiment toward EVLV in the upcoming weeks, alongside updates on previously announced strategic partnership deployments.
